Pipeline Monitoring Startup runs equipment in environments that punish control systems and test infrastructure: high pressures, hazardous fluids, dirty power, and remote sites. Lab and field test data need to be trustworthy the first time, because re-running a campaign is rarely cheap or fast.

Good Automation engaged across a single focused engagement. Each scope was treated as production-grade work: clean architecture, structured V&V where required, and documentation the customer's own engineers could pick up and extend.

Real-time pipeline breach detection RTOS software

Developed RTOS (Real-Time Operating System) software for a sensor package that detects pipeline breaches and occlusions for the client.
